Decatur, TX and Sheldon, TX have a very similar cost of living, with only a 3.1% difference in their overall index. Decatur scores 89 while Sheldon scores 86 on the cost of living index, where 100 represents the national average. The day-to-day expenses for residents in both cities are comparable, though differences emerge when looking at specific categories.

On the housing front, median rent in Decatur is $1,089/month compared to $1,432/month in Sheldon — a 24% difference. Interestingly, home values tell a different story: while Decatur has cheaper rent, Sheldon actually has lower median home values ($94,400 vs $242,200).

Median household income in Decatur is $71,919 compared to $72,937 in Sheldon (-1.4%). Sheldon off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power. Looking at affordability, residents of Decatur spend roughly 18.2% of their income on rent, less than the 23.6% in Sheldon.
